MetaMask是一款流行的数字钱包,主要用于以太坊及其代币(如ERC-20代币)的管理。然而,许多用户也希望通过MetaMask管理其他加密货币,如比特币(BTC)。由于MetaMask本身并不原生支持比特币,但用户仍然可以借助一些方法在MetaMask中添加与比特币相关的代币或资产。本文将为您提供完整的指南,带您一步步了解如何在MetaMask中添加代币BTC。

一、理解MetaMask与比特币的关系

首先,我们需要明确MetaMask的定位。MetaMask是基于以太坊的去中心化钱包,主要用于存储和交易以太坊及其标准代币(ERC-20)。虽然比特币并不是以太坊网络上的资产,但我们可以通过各种代币表现形式将其引入到MetaMask中。例如,有些项目会将比特币通过锚定机制转换为ERC-20代币形式(如Wrapped Bitcoin,WBTC),以便用户能够在以太坊网络上进行交易。

二、通过Wrapped Bitcoin (WBTC) 将BTC添加到MetaMask

Wrapped Bitcoin(WBTC)是一个以太坊标准的ERC-20代币,它的价值与比特币直接挂钩。这个代币的存在使得比特币的持有者可以在以太坊网络上进行交易和金融操作。以下是通过MetaMask添加WBTC的具体步骤:

步骤1:安装MetaMask
如果您还没有安装MetaMask扩展,请首先前往官方MetaMask网站(https://metamask.io/)并安装。按照步骤完成设置后,您就能访问MetaMask钱包。

步骤2:获取WBTC地址
在MetaMask中添加代币,您需要先获取WBTC的合约地址。截稿时,WBTC的ERC-20合约地址为:0xwrappingBitcoin(请注意,务必在ETHERSCANS等官方网站上验证这个地址)。

步骤3:添加WBTC到MetaMask
登录您的MetaMask账户,点击“资产”页签,然后选择“添加代币”。在“代币合约地址”栏中输入之前获取的WBTC地址。接下来,MetaMask将自动填充代币符号和精度(通常为8),确认无误后点击“下一步”并完成添加。

三、如何购买或获得WBTC

获得WBTC的方法有多种,用户可以选择以下方式之一:

1. 通过交易所购买:许多主流的加密交易所(如Binance、Coinbase等)都支持WBTC的交易。您可以直接用法币或其他加密货币(如以太坊)购买WBTC,购买后可以将其转入您的MetaMask钱包。

2. 使用跨链转移协议:如RenVM等跨链服务,允许用户将比特币通过跨链技术转换为WBTC。通过这些服务,用户只需在比特币网络和以太坊网络之间进行资产转移即可。

四、在MetaMask中管理和使用WBTC

一旦WBTC被成功添加到您的MetaMask中,您就可以开始管理和使用您的代币了。您可以通过以下方式进行操作:

1. 进行交易:通过去中心化交易所(如Uniswap、SushiSwap等),用户可以使用WBTC进行交易。您只需选择适当的交易对并按照流程完成交易。

2. 参与DeFi协议:WBTC作为ERC-20资产可以被用于多种DeFi金融产品,如借贷、流动性挖矿等。您可以在相应的DeFi平台上使用WBTC进行操作,以获取利息或者参与流动性池获得收益。

3. 提取成比特币:如果您想将WBTC转换回比特币,可以通过协议将它兑换回比特币,或是前往支持WBTC提现的交易所进行交易。

五、常见问题解答

接下来,我们将探讨一些与MetaMask和BTC相关的常见问题,帮助您更深入地了解如何在这个平台上运作。

如何确保在MetaMask中添加的代币是安全的?

在MetaMask中添加代币时,安全性是非常关键的。以下是一些确保安全的步骤:

1. 验证合约地址:在添加任何代币之前,务必确认合约地址的正确性。请访问可信的网站,如Etherscan,逐一查找并验证合约地址,确保没有拼写错误。

2. 了解项目背景:在决定添加一个新的代币之前,建议对该代币的背后项目或团队进行仔细研究,查看其官网、社交平台以及社区反馈等信息。群体的声音往往能提供重要的判断依据。

3. 不要随便添加不明来源代币:随机添加某个代币的合约地址极有可能让您遭受损失,特别是在假冒的合约中。您可先深入了解该项目,获取更多用户反馈;极大程度地避免心理上的冲动选择。

MetaMask不支持直接存储比特币,为什么?

MetaMask以太坊为基础,它的架构是专门为以太坊及其标准代币设计的,而比特币属于另一个区块链体系。论文解释了为什么MetaMask原生不支持比特币:

1. 不同区块链技术:比特币使用的是UTXO(未花费交易输出)模型,而以太坊使用账户模型。这两种模型的储存和管理方式有本质上的区别,因此MetaMask原生无法处理比特币。

2. 专注核心业务:MetaMask一直专注于构建以太坊生态以及ERC-20代币的应用,扩展到其他区块链可能会干扰其产品的核心功能和体验。

3. 安全性和易用性:将比特币直接集成到MetaMask可能会引入更多的安全风险,并增加用户的使用复杂度。MetaMask希望保持其用户友好的设计风格,因此选择不支持非以太坊资产。

如何选择合适的汇率,并在交换WBTC与BTC时避免损失?

比特币和WBTC之间的汇率并非固定,会随市场供需变化而波动。因此,选择适合的时机进行兑换变得至关重要。以下几种方法可以帮助您降低转换时的损失:

1. 监测市场趋势:使用价格追踪工具来观察BTC和WBTC的实时价格变化。从不同平台比较汇率,并利用套利机会获得最佳交易价格。

2. 选择信誉良好的交易所:选择知名的交易所进行兑换,以确保流动性和服务质量。这可以最大程度地减少由于交易量不足带来的汇率滑点损失。

3. 注意手续费:在兑换WBTC和BTC时,务必注意手续费。在整个兑换过程中,手续费可能会显著影响到您最终的收益。因此,选择交易费相对较低的平台可以提高您的交易效益。

如何确保通过MetaMask进行的交易是安全的?

在MetaMask中进行交易时,用户需要尽可能降低遭受黑客攻击和诈骗的风险。以下几个方面可以确保交易的安全性:

1. 启用二次验证:务必为您的账户启用移动设备上的二次验证功能,这可以增强账户的安全性,即使密码被攻破也能防止黑客的进一步入侵。

2. 保持软件更新:定期更新您使用的浏览器及MetaMask扩展,以确保使用的是最新版本,减少潜在的安全漏洞。

3. 不随意连接不明网站:在进行交易时,确保您连接的网站是合法且好评较多的平台。此外,在浏览器中使用“不要跟踪”功能,防止隐私泄露或恶意程序的植入。

通过本文的细致介绍,相信您已经掌握了如何在MetaMask中添加代币BTC(如WBTC)以及确保交易安全的重要知识。借助MetaMask,您将能够灵活管理加密资产,参与丰富的DeFi协议和生态系统。